Dmitry Vasilev was born in Odessa, Ukraine.
He graduated from Moscow State Horeographic Institute in 2011.
A year before his graduation Dmitry was invited to join the Kremlin Ballet. Vasilev debute in Corsaire at the Kremlin Ballet Theatre was successful enough to make him a soloist.
Dmitry Vasilev has joined the Russian Grand Ballet in 2013. Since then he has been touring the world, dancing principal roles in many countries, including Netherlands, Germany, France, China.
His repertoire includes Pas des Trois in the Swan Lake, Blue Bird in the Sleeping Beauty, Ivan in the Little Humpbacked Horse, Prince in the Cinderella, Basil in the Don Quixote, Jose in the Gloria Carmen, Lanquedem in Le Corsaire.
